NFL 2025 Week 20 (Division Championships) Predictions – Zoltar Agrees with Las Vegas but if Forced Would Pick Underdog Bears Against Rams

Zoltar is my NFL football prediction computer program. It uses a neural network and a type of reinforcement learning. Here are Zoltar’s predictions for week #20 (division championship games) of the 2025 season.

Zoltar:     broncos  by    4  opp =       bills    | Vegas:     broncos  by    1
Zoltar:    seahawks  by    6  opp = fortyniners    | Vegas:    seahawks  by  7.5
Zoltar:      texans  by    0  opp =    patriots    | Vegas:    patriots  by  2.5
Zoltar:        rams  by    0  opp =       bears    | Vegas:        rams  by    4

Zoltar theoretically suggests betting when the Vegas line is “significantly” different from Zoltar’s prediction. For this season I’ve been using a conservative threshold of 4 points difference in the early and late parts of the season, and a more aggressive threshold of 3 points difference in the middle of the season.

For week #20 Zoltar agrees closely with the Las Vegas point spread, meaning all of Zoltar’s predictions are 4 points or less than the Vegas point spread. But if forced to make a recommendation, Zoltar would suggest a bet on the Vegas underdog Chicago Bears against the Los Angeles Rams.

Zoltar thinks the game is dead even, but Vegas favors the Rams by 4 points. A bet on the underdog Bears will pay if the Bears win by any score, or if the Rams win but by less than 4.0 points (i.e., 3 points or less). If the Rams win by exactly 4 points, all bets are a push.

Theoretically, if you must bet $110 to win $100 (typical in Vegas) then you’ll make money if you predict at 53% accuracy or better. But realistically, you need to predict at 60% accuracy or better to account for logisitics and things like data entry errors.

In week #19, against the Vegas point spread, Zoltar went 1-0 using 4.0 points as the advice threshold. Zoltar liked underdog Panthers against the Rams. The Rams won the game 34-31 but they did not cover the 10.0 point spread.

For the season, against the spread, Zoltar is 47-30 (~61% accuracy).

My system is named after the Zoltar fortune teller machine you can find in arcades. I’ve always been fascinated by mechanical fortune tellers. Artist Thomas Kuntz makes incredible automata, including this “L’Oracle du Mort”. The user inserts a small card, with a question like “How rich will I be?” into a tray at the front of the machine. The magician / oracle figure comes to life and consults his crystal ball, lights a flame, and opens the circular door held by the skeleton to reveal the answer. See the machine in action at youtube.com/watch?v=GI1LnFUSejU. The machine is currently owned by Oscar-winning director Guillermo del Toro.
